I have them. I don't think anyone has ever asked about them, let alone commented on them. Most line pilots who were CFI's, that I know, haven't bothered to maintain their CFI. The IGI and AGI don't expire, but I have never met anyone in the last few decades who gave two stuffs about my having them. I seriously doubt they'd make the difference in getting hired anywhere but perhaps an instructing environment.

CFI has this requirement:

§ 61.189 Flight instructor records.

(b) A flight instructor must maintain a record in a logbook or a separate document that contains the following:

(2) The name of each person that instructor has endorsed for a knowledge test or practical test, and the record shall also indicate the kind of test, the date, and the results.

(c) Each flight instructor must retain the records required by this section for at least 3 years.

Ground instructor doesn't. It is one small relief from record keeping.
